Thomas Cook

Good old Thomas Cook are coming up trumps for me again. I booked a return from Gatwick to Dalaman for March the other day for £80. Today I have booked another one to Dalaman in April. This time going from Gatwick and returning to Birmingham. It was £183 to include meals. I would have preferred to go from Birmingham but was tied to travelling on 22nd. and Birmingham didn't have that day so never mind at least I won't have a long final leg on the way back.
I was very pleased with these prices as I was expecting them to be much more. I also like the facility to book outward and return flights separately meaning you can come and go from different airports and are not stuck with the traditional 7 or 14 days.

Re: Thomas Cook

When I first found our flight the price was £160. When I looked later it had gone up to £326!. So I cleared my 'cookies' out and the flight was £160 again.
Obviously these companies download a 'cookie' onto your computer and know that you are interested in a flight and put the price up hoping that you will be forced to buy as the price is going up.

So well worth clearing your 'cookies' before buying a flight ticket
